What is a Single Wire Cable?


A single wire cable consists of a single conductive metal (typically copper or aluminum) that carries electric current. It is insulated with a non-conductive material, which serves to protect the wire from environmental factors and prevent electrical short circuits. The insulation also affects the cable's overall durability, flexibility, and heat resistance, making it suitable for various applications.


Key Features of Single Wire Cables


1. Simplicity The design of single wire cables is straightforward, comprising just one conductor. This simplicity can lead to easier installation and maintenance compared to multi-conductor cables.


2. Efficiency Single wire cables typically have lower resistance and, thus, can transmit electricity more efficiently over short distances. This characteristic is particularly advantageous in applications requiring high current flow.


3. Variety of Insulation Depending on the intended use, single wire cables can be insulated with various materials—like PVC, rubber, or polyethylene—to enhance their performance and suit specific environments.


4. Versatility Available in different gauges and sizes, single wire cables can be used for diverse applications, ranging from powering small devices to larger electrical systems.


Benefits of Using Single Wire Cables


1. Cost-Effectiveness Due to their simplicity, single wire cables are often more affordable than their multi-conductor counterparts. Lower production costs and ease of handling contribute to significant savings in large-scale installations.


2. Reduced Complexity In situations where multiple conductors are not necessary, using single wire cables reduces the complexity of wiring systems. This reduction minimizes the risk of wiring errors, improving reliability and safety.

3. Customization Single wire cables can be easily customized to meet specific requirements. Whether it's adjusting the gauge for desired current capacity or selecting insulation materials for specific environmental conditions, their adaptability is a key advantage.


4. Lightweight and Flexible Compared to multi-core cables, single wire cables are generally lighter and more flexible, making them easier to handle and install, especially in tight or awkward spaces.


Applications of Single Wire Cables


Single wire cables are employed in various applications across numerous industries


- Residential Wiring Used for simple circuit connections in homes, such as connecting light fixtures and outlets.


- Automotive In vehicles, single wire cables are often used for battery connections and various electrical systems due to their reliability and efficiency.


- Telecommunications They are prevalent in telecommunications for data transmission and grounding systems.


- Industrial Equipment Many industrial machines utilize single wire cables for their power supply and operational controls, capitalizing on their robustness and efficiency.


- Solar Power Systems In renewable energy applications, single wire cables form crucial components in the wiring of solar panels and battery systems.
